Tunefish 4 for linux

Description:

Tunefish 4, which is currently at version 4.0.1 for the linux platform, is a virtual synthesizer developed by Christian 'Payne' Loos and the Brain Control group. It utilizes an additive-synthesis-based wavetable generator with graphic wave display, and provides further sonic controls such as Damp, Spread, Drive and Scale. It also includes a noise generator section with adjustable frequency and bandwidth.

Like Tunefish 3, this softsynth includes a filter section with mixable lowpass, highpass, bandpass and band-reject (notch) filters; two separate ADSR envelopes; two assignable LFOs; chainable effects: chorus, flanger, delay, reverb, 3-band EQ, formant and distortion. The Mod Matrix on the righthand side of the GUI allows assigning of many parameters to controls such as the ADSR envelopes and the LFOs.
